Course Content

• Introduction to Cognitive Neuroscience & Nutrition
• The Mind-Gut Connection: Microbiome & Behavior
• Cognitive Processes in Food Choice & Consumption (Cognitive biases, decision-making)
• Sensory Perception & Food Preference (Taste, smell, texture)
• Nutritional Interventions for Cognitive Enhancement
• Cognitive Nutrition & Mental Health (Depression, anxiety, stress)
• Behavioral Change Strategies in Nutritional Counseling
• Research Methods in Cognitive Nutrition (Data analysis, experimental design)
